Al Carnevale,69,died August 13, at his house in Bedford, Ohio. He was born in Parkersburg, West Virginia, on July 1, 1916, leaving this country at the age of five, for Carovilli, Italy, where he received his education. He returned to the United States when he was 19, making his home in Bedford, Ohio. Mr. Carnevale began his career as a carpenter at the Taylor Chair Company of Bedford, later working in a defense plant as an aeronautical engineer during WWII. In 1959 he formed Al Carnevale & Son Builders. He left many fine examples of his craftsmanship throughout the community, his proudest accomplishments the Bedford Gazebo on the Square and the Willard Park Pavillion at the Ellenwood Community Center, where he spent many happy hours since his retirement in 1981. He derived much pleasure from his yearly vegetable garden and labored many hours in his yard, creating a park-like atmosphere and enjoying the compliments and comments of family and friends as well as many passers-by.
Survivors include his wife of 45 years, the former Mildred Guintoi, children Al Jr., Donna and Rich; grandchildren Alan, Michael and Kristie Carnevale, Lisa, Thomas and Robert Kropf, and Jordan Carnevale; brothers Angelo and Albet Carnevale of Columbus; sisters Lucy DiFrangia of Carovilli, Italy and Olga DeFrangia of Akron. Services were at St. Mary's Church, Bedford, August 16 with interment in Bedford Cemetery. Arrangements were by Johnson-Romito Funeral Home. (Bedford Times-Register, Thurs. Aug.22, 1985)
